Dose Escalation Versus Standard in Laryngopharyngeal Cancers (INTELHOPE)
Intensifying Radiation Treatment in Advanced/ Poor Prognosis Laryngeal, Hypopharyngeal (LH) and Oropharyngeal Cancers (OPC) Using PET -CT Based Dose Escalation Strategies ( INTELHOPE)
Sponsor: Tata Medical Center
This NA trial investigates Malignant Neoplasm of Hypopharynx Stage III and Malignant Neoplasm of Hypopharynx Stage IVa and is currently completed.
